So I started this Journey in Feb weighing in at 430 pounds. For the last two weeks I have been on a high Protein, low carb low fat 1200 calorie diet. I know weight 395 pounds. I have done pretty darn good over the last two weeks but of course still nervous because what if I did not do enough.
Basically I had a Protein shake for Breakfast and lunch and a protein choice meat for dinner with a salad or vegetable. Also I could have had a 100 calorie snack at night but I chose not to do that or if I did had another protein shake or something like that. Now with my work schedule I have kinda rearranged the order at times but I think I have remained within the 1200 calorie limit.
I have 3 days left. I ended up having for breakfast this morning a round steak on the grill. Only reason I did that was because I only had a tuna sandwich wrapped in a lettuce leaf from Jimmy Johns and two salads later on. Sandwich was only about 255 calories. I used fat free french dressing with my salad.
Well I want to make sure over the last 3 days, well more like 2 because I cant eat on Sunday cause my surgery is Monday that I stay really strict.
Anyway, just thought I would share. Wish me luck!
